This is the source of the perennial rivers in India 

A) High rainfall in Deccan plateau 

B) Accumulation of ice, movement and melting of glaciers 

C) Born in western ghats 

D) Retreating monsoons

Share with your friends

B) Accumulation of ice, movement and melting of glaciers

Talk Doctor Online in Bissoy App